  13. 13. This annual two-day exhibition and museum fundraiser features innovative floral displays created by award-winning floral designers from across the Midwest. The floral arrangements are in response to works in KAM’s permanent collection. The exhibition is curated by Rick Orr, a member of the American Institute of Floral Designers.   17. 17. Now Now April 3, 3 pm Throughout this dance performance, U of I professor of Dance Kirstie Simson will explore the full potential of the piece as an improvsational art. Rooted deeply in the human nature of dance and its relevance for our world today, Simson is joined by Tim O’Donnell, a dance artist currently living and working in NYC.
